You could go into your f8 menu again and select brl. You can then type ASCII
code between the style markers. For example: <brl>;;;</brl> would give you the
grade 1 passage indicator. If you don't have the brl style you could try
entering the semi-colons between Alt0 Alt2. (Alt 0 puts you into ASCII, Alt2
back into grade 2.) For example: [cz];;;[tx][g2] would also give you the grade
1 passage indicator. You would also need to insert the passage terminator in
the same way.

The template I am using in Duxbury 12.2 SR1 has a grade 1 style that can be
applied. I highlight the passage and press f8 which show you the "Apply Style"
window. You can scroll or type "g" to find "grade1". If you don't have that
in your template you could use "Alt1" at the start of the passage. "Alt2" at
the end of the passage would put you back into grade 2.
